What is GBT?

Guided Biofilm Therapy (GBT) is a state-of-the-art technology that completely removes biofilm, discolorations, and calculus.

GBT uses innovative technologies while being gentle on the tooth surfaces and gums.

GBT is a painless, fast, and safe method that helps you keep your teeth healthy.

GBT also supports your overall health for a lifetime.

How Does GBT Work?

GBT benefits

  • Effective biofilm removal: GBT helps to thoroughly eliminate biofilm, reducing the risk of cavities and gum disease.
  • Gentle and comfortable: The process is designed to be minimally invasive and comfortable for patients.
  • Improved oral health: Regular GBT treatments can lead to better overall oral health and prevent more serious dental problems.
  • Early detection: GBT can help detect dental issues early when treatment is more effective and less invasive.
